range是用于 picker 渲染的动态数据,其语法格式是 `[[第一列数据], [第二列数据], [第三列数据]]`,在我们这个需求中,除了第一列数据是不变的之外,第二列和第三列数据都会随着父级数据的变化而变化。 range-key用于指定使用哪个字段来渲染 picker 视图。 <template> <picker mode="multiSelector" @change...
<viewclass="item"><viewclass="left">服务产品:</view><pickermode="multiSelector"class="right"bindchange="bindMultiPickerChange"bindcolumnchange="bindMultiPickerColumnChange"value="{{multiIndex}}"range-key="name"range="{{multiArray}}"><!-- <view class="picker">{{productcate}}</view> --><...
range:mode为 selector 或 multiSelector 时,range 有效,默认[],值的类型是数组或对象数组; range-key:当 range 是一个 Object Array 时,通过 range-key 来指定 Object 中 key 的值作为选择器显示内容,值为string; value:表示选择了 range 中的第几个(下标从 0 开始),值为number,默认为0 bindchange:valu...
多列选择器:mode = multiSelector(属性名类型默认值说明最低版本 range 二维Array / 二维Object Array [] mode为 selector 或 multiSelector 时,range 有效。二维数组,长度表示多少列,数组的每项表示每列的数据,如[["a","b"], ["c","d"]] range-key String 当range 是一个 二维Object Array 时,...
mode 为 selector 或 multiSelector 时,range 有效。 range-key string - 当range 是一个 Object Array 时,通过 range-key 来指定 Object 中 key 的值作为选择器显示内容。 value array [] 表示选择了 range 中的第几个(下标从 0 开始)。 bindchange eventhandle - value 改变时触发 ...
<picker mode="multiSelector" bindchange="bindMultiPickerChange" bindcolumnchange="bindMultiPickerColumnChange" value="{{multiIndex}}" range="{{multiArray}}"> <view class="picker"> 当前选择:{{multiArray[0][multiIndex[0]]}} > {{multiArray[1][multiIndex[1]]}} ...
range-key=“funding_name” 也就是 代码语言:javascript 代码运行次数:0 运行 AI代码解释 <picker mode="selector"range="{{array}}"range-key="funding_name"value="{{index}}"bindchange="bindPickerChange"class="picker"style="width:580rpx;"><view>{{array[index]['funding_name']}}</view></pic...
mode = multiSelector(最低版本:1.4.0)。 属性名 类型 默认值 说明 range 二维Array / 二维Object Array [] mode为 selector 或 multiSelector 时,range 有效。二维数组,长度表示多少列,数组的每项表示每列的数据,如[[“a”,”b”], [“c”,”d”]] range-key String 当range 是一个 二维Object Ar...
问题描述 点击“测试”二字后弹出picker进行选择时会报错,"Attempted to assign to readonly property." 复现步骤 [复现问题的步骤] <picker mode="multiSelector" :range="objectMultiArray" range-key="id"> <view class="picker">测试</view> </picker> <script> export
mode == 'selector') { this.input = this.range[e[0]]; } else if (this.mode == 'multiSelector') { this.input = this.range[0][e[0]] + '-' + this.range[1][e[1]] + '-' + this.range[2][e[2]]; } }, columnchange(e) { let column = e.column, index = e.index;...